How It Began
A Safe Space was founded in 2023 by a group of community members who were deeply moved by what they saw around them — people struggling without access to grounding, supportive alternatives to healing. They believed something better was possible, and they came together to build it.
What started as a shared vision grew into an organized effort — bringing together farmers, healers, educators, and neighbors united by one purpose: creating spaces where anyone who needs to reconnect with themselves and the earth is truly welcome.
Today, A Safe Space is actively expanding its outreach — developing farm sites, building therapeutic programs, and offering an open door to veterans, children, families, and anyone seeking a grounded path toward healing.

What We Stand For
We believe nature is medicine. Our horticultural therapy programs give veterans with PTSD a structured, peaceful alternative to clinical-only treatment — one rooted in purpose and the rhythm of growing things.
Children who learn to grow food grow into stewards of the earth. Our summer farm schools teach practical sustainability skills — and give kids a hands-on connection to where their food comes from.
A Safe Space means exactly that. Veterans, families, seniors, people in recovery, neighbors — everyone is welcome here, no experience required. The only rule is kindness.
We are stronger together. Our programs only work because volunteers, donors, farmers, and neighbors show up for each other — season after season.
